While Republicans greeted the news that Emanuel would take the White House helm with some trepidation, he has since surprised many of the worried by courting them. One of his first meetings on Capitol Hill after taking the job was with the Senate GOP leadership. "He gave us all his personal cell-phone" number, said Nevada Senator John Ensign. "He said he promised to get back to us on issues within 24 hours." But Emanuel cannot count on these moments of goodwill to last for long. The position is not one for anybody who craves job security. ...nation's largest left-leaning think tanks - the New Democracy Project and the Center for American Progress Action Fund - this collection of 67 agency-by-agency, issue-by-issue essays serves as a bible of progressive thought. It is modeled after 1980's Mandate for Leadership, a book which greatly influenced Ronald Reagan's transition team. Seeing as John Podesta, head of the Center for American Progress, was the head of Barack Obama's transition team, it stands to reason that these recommendations will receive serious consideration.
